diff --git a/cpp/src/strings/json/json_path.cu b/cpp/src/strings/json/json_path.cu index 8de9915a668..ba3bcf79004 100644 --- a/cpp/src/strings/json/json_path.cu +++ b/cpp/src/strings/json/json_path.cu @@ -98,6 +98,44 @@ class parser { return false; } + CUDA_HOST_DEVICE_CALLABLE bool is_hex_digit(char c) + { + return (c >= '0' && c <= '9') || (c >= 'a' && c <= 'f') || (c >= 'A' && c <= 'F'); + } + + CUDA_HOST_DEVICE_CALLABLE int64_t chars_left() { return input_len - ((pos - input) + 1); } + + /** + * @brief Parse an escape sequence. + * + * Must be a valid sequence as specified by the JSON format + * https://www.json.org/json-en.html + * + * @returns True on success or false on fail. + */ + CUDA_HOST_DEVICE_CALLABLE bool parse_escape_seq() + { + if (*pos != '\\') { return false; } + char c = *++pos; + + // simple case + if (c == '\"' || c == '\\' || c == '/' || c == 'b' || c == 'f' || c == 'n' || c == 'r' || + c == 't') { + pos++; + return true; + } + + // hex digits: must be of the form uXXXX where each X is a valid hex digit + if (c == 'u' && chars_left() >= 4 && is_hex_digit(pos[1]) && is_hex_digit(pos[2]) && + is_hex_digit(pos[3]) && is_hex_digit(pos[4])) { + pos += 5; + return true; + } + + // an illegal escape sequence. + return false; + } + /** * @brief Parse a quote-enclosed JSON string. * @@ -122,12 +160,16 @@ class parser { const char* start = ++pos; while (!eof()) { - if (*pos == quote) { + // handle escaped characters + if (*pos == '\\') { + if (!parse_escape_seq()) { return parse_result::ERROR; } + } else if (*pos == quote) { str = string_view(start, pos - start); pos++; return parse_result::SUCCESS; + } else { + pos++; } - pos++; } } } @@ -229,15 +271,22 @@ class json_state : private parser { int arr_count = 0; while (!eof(end)) { - // could do some additional checks here. we know our current - // element type, so we could be more strict on what kinds of - // characters we expect to see. - switch (*end++) { - case '{': obj_count++; break; - case '}': obj_count--; break; - case '[': arr_count++; break; - case ']': arr_count--; break; - default: break; + // parse strings explicitly so we handle all interesting corner cases (such as strings + // containing {, }, [ or ] + if (is_quote(*end)) { + string_view str; + pos = end; + if (parse_string(str, false, *end) == parse_result::ERROR) { return parse_result::ERROR; } + end = pos; + } else { + char const c = *end++; + switch (c) { + case '{': obj_count++; break; + case '}': obj_count--; break; + case '[': arr_count++; break; + case ']': arr_count--; break; + default: break; + } } if (obj_count == 0 && arr_count == 0) { break; } } diff --git a/cpp/tests/strings/json_tests.cpp b/cpp/tests/strings/json_tests.cpp index 5c81057b6d7..dfcc646a8f6 100644 --- a/cpp/tests/strings/json_tests.cpp +++ b/cpp/tests/strings/json_tests.cpp @@ -76,10 +76,10 @@ std::unique_ptr drop_whitespace(cudf::column_view const& col) return cudf::strings::replace(strings, targets, replacements);
